Flood Warning issued June 5 at 11:43AM CDT until June 12 at 4:00PM CDT by NWS Twin Cities/Chanhassen MN

Официальные разъяснения по предупреждению:

The Flood Warning continues for the following rivers in Minnesota

Minnesota River near Jordan affecting Carver, Sibley and Scott Counties.

Minnesota River at Henderson MN19 affecting Sibley, Scott and Le Sueur Counties.

Minnesota River at Morton affecting Redwood and Renville Counties.

Minnesota River at Montevideo affecting Chippewa, Yellow Medicine and Lac qui Parle Counties.

The Flood Warning is extended for the following rivers in Minnesota

Minnesota River at Savage affecting Carver, Scott, Dakota and Hennepin Counties.

South Fork Crow River below Mayer affecting Carver County.

The Flood Warning is cancelled for the following rivers in Minnesota

Cannon River at Northfield affecting Rice and Dakota Counties.

  • No major changes to the current flood warnings with some minor modifications to account for reactions due to rainfall on Tuesday.

The one exception is the Cannon River at Northfield which is now forecast to stay below Flood Stage.

  • WHAT: Minor flooding is occurring and minor flooding is forecast.

  • WHERE: Minnesota River near Jordan.

  • WHEN: Until Wednesday, June 12.

  • IMPACTS: At 26.7 feet, The bridge at Scott County Road 9 and Carver County Road 11/Jonathan Carver Parkway will be closed.

  • ADDITIONAL DETAILS:

    • At 1045 AM CDT Wednesday, the stage was 26.4 feet.
    • Recent Activity: The maximum river stage in the 24 hours ending at 1045 AM CDT Wednesday was 26.4 feet.
    • Forecast: The river is expected to rise to a crest of 26.5 feet this evening. It will then fall below flood stage late Tuesday evening.
    • Flood stage is 25.0 feet.
    • Flood History: This crest compares to a previous crest of 26.5 feet on 03/12/2020.

Официальные разъяснения по предупреждению:

The Flood Warning is extended for the following rivers in Minnesota

Minnesota River near Jordan affecting Scott, Sibley and Carver Counties.

Minnesota River at Henderson MN19 affecting Le Sueur, Scott and Sibley Counties.

The Flood Warning continues for the following rivers in Minnesota

South Fork Crow River below Mayer affecting Carver County.

Minnesota River at Savage affecting Dakota, Scott, Hennepin and Carver Counties.

Minnesota River at Morton affecting Redwood and Renville Counties.

Minnesota River at Montevideo affecting Chippewa, Lac qui Parle and Yellow Medicine Counties.

  • No major changes to the current flood warnings with some minor modifications to account for reactions due to recent rainfall.

  • WHAT: Minor flooding is occurring and minor flooding is forecast.

  • WHERE: Minnesota River at Savage.

  • WHEN: Until further notice.

  • IMPACTS: At 705.0 feet, Flood waters begin to impact the park road at Fort Snelling State Park.

  • ADDITIONAL DETAILS:

    • At 900 PM CDT Wednesday, the stage was 702.5 feet.
    • Recent Activity: The maximum river stage in the 24 hours ending at 900 PM CDT Wednesday was 702.5 feet.
    • Forecast: The river is expected to rise to a crest of 705.0 feet Saturday evening.
    • Flood stage is 702.0 feet.
    • Flood History: This crest compares to a previous crest of 705.0 feet on 04/06/2020.
